Description: We'll critically examine the recent open letter signed by more than 60 CEOs of Minnesota-based companies and respectfully ask deeper ethical questions: When does corporate purpose cross the line into purpose-washing? Through an I-O psychology lens, we explore how ethics can be diluted when leadership behavior prioritizes reputational safety, consensus signaling, and risk avoidance over psychological safety, moral courage, and meaningful action. This discussion focuses on ethical climate, moral disengagement, and the psychological consequences for employees when leadership values are communicated symbolically but not enacted behaviorally. Listeners will gain insight into how performative ethics erode trust, disengage employees, and undermine long-term organizational credibility, and what ethical leadership looks like when it requires discomfort, accountability, and real tradeoffs.
